Highlights

At upper elevations pockets of soft slab 8 inches to 1 foot deep exist in the starting zones and under cornices. HUMAN TRIGGERED AVALANCHES ARE POSSIBLE. At mid elevations some wet loose snow avalanches are possible if ambiant air temperatures warm up. At lower elevations expect some wet loose snow sluffing off road cuts and steep banks as ambiant air temperatures warm up.
